Mark Hamill Hints That His Time As The Joker Is Over

Matt Anderson This comes courtesy of an interview with Empire Magazine, where Hamill noted that the recent passing of Batman actor Kevin Conroy has shaped his decision to leave the character. The two were an almost inseparable pair, and Hamill would only ever return to play the Joker if Conroy was back as Batman. “They would call and say, ‘They want you to do the Joker,’ and my only question was, ‘Is Kevin Batman?...

Marvel Snap S Latest Patch Tones Down Mr Negative Sera Magik Left Untouched

Zhiqing Wan Second Dinner has just released a new patch to re-balance a whole bunch of cards, and while Mr. Negative has gotten a power hit, Sera and Magik remain safe for now. Here are the changes: Arnim Zola: No longer adds copies of a card if his target was not destroyed.Baron Mordo: [2/3] On Reveal: Your opponent draws a card. Set its Cost to 6. Developer Comment: Baron Mordo’s Cost increase tends to be very inconsequential in practice....

Microsoft Accidentally Releases Faulty Update That Crashes Phones And Computers

According to the recent reports from MSPowerUser, Microsoft just rolled out the Windows 10 build 16212 for x86 computers and phone running Windows 10. The latest build actually contains bugs which are crashing phones and computers. Users are experiencing crashes and boot loop issue after updating to the Build 16212. The build is expected to be only available to Windows Insiders in the Fast, Slow and Release Preview rings. However, it looks like the build had rolled out to some regular users who aren’t the member of any Windows Insider program....

More Than 250 Games On Android Use Your Mic To Track What You Re Watching

According to the reports from NYTimes, more than 250 Games that were found on Android’s Google Play Store can track your TV viewing habits. The worst thing is that these apps can track your activities when they are not being played. Such apps are also found in the iOS store. However, such malicious apps on iOS platform are lesser in number. All of those malicious app uses software from Alphonso, which is a startup that collects users TV viewing data and sells it to advertisers....
